So for the last few days, if I start my car remotely, the blower does not work in addition to several starts after that. It doesn't matter what driving mode or climate mode I have it set to; the fans will just not turn on.

I have a service appointment scheduled for Monday, but I'm curious if anyone else has run I to this. I'm able to get the fans going again after starting the car several more times. There's no rhyme or reason to it, though.

What I'm hoping doesn't happen is the service tech will see the fans working fine, because sometimes they do.

Yeah, at first they tried replacing the fan blower motor because they said it was faulty. It didn't resolve the issue though, so they also had to replace the controller module. Luckily all covered under warranty.
